Requirements: **Position Details for Emergency Medicine Coverage**

- **Specialty**: Emergency Medicine Physician (MD/DO)

- **Coverage Period**: July to September 2026 -

- **Shift Schedule**

Available shifts from 7 PM to 8 AM or 8 AM to 7 PM; candidates should specify available days in their presentation

- **Type of Privileges**: Hospital-based

- **Work Setting**: Outpatient and inpatient (Emergency Department primarily operates as outpatient)

- **Patient Demographics**: Diverse populations

- **Patient Volume**: Approximately 41 patients per day

- **Required Procedures**: Standard emergency room procedures

- **Staffing**: Solo practice, though day shifts may have Advanced Practice Provider (APP) assistance

- **Electronic Medical Record System**: EPIC

**Certification Requirements**

  • Board Certification in Emergency Medicine
  • Current Basic Life Support (BLS),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S),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S), and Advanced Trauma Life Support (ATLS)/Trauma Nursing Core Course (TNCC) certifications (from American Heart Association or American Red Cross)

**Licensure**

• Candidates must possess an active Oregon license at the time of application

**Clinical Activity Requirement**

• Documentation of clinical activity within the last 24 months is required, including case logs that demonstrate the provision of emergency medicine services reflecting the scope and complexity of requested privileges.
